I'm proud of my 25,201 points. Also proud how it ends in a 1 because most people don't have that. I think I started out like this guy: . Achievements are stupid...well maybe I'll just get a few more...
Seriously though, they do make you play the game in a way you probably wouldn't and extend the life of it. For example, in Red Dead Redemption you get one called "Dastardly" for tying up a women and putting her on the tracks for "death by train". Certainly wouldn't have thought of that. That being said I'm not crazy like some people who will invest dozens of hours into getting another 10 points. I grab the easy ones where I can.
